The format of the personas was decided upon:

* Overview:

  1. Name
  2. Age
  3. Weight/Height
  4. Parents
  5. Siblings
  6. Extended family (optional, depends on the character)
  7. House location/home life
  8. Household income
  9. Eating habits
  10. Academic record
  11. Disabilities (optional, obviously depends on the character)
  12. Hobbies

* A day in the life: (as noted on the Microsoft template posted before)

* Goals, fears and aspirations: (as noted on the Microsoft template)

* Computer skills: (as noted on the Microsoft template)

* Market size and influence: (as noted on the Microsoft template)

We decided it was not necessary to declare each point implicitly in the persona description, but hitting all the bases should ensure all the personas have the same information.
